Big Country Posted June 29, 2007 Share Posted June 29, 2007 I dont do the deal either. LEt's face it, it is an essential wash at RB performance wise over the next couple years, so the only benefit is getting younger there, but not neccessarily gaining anything. THen to do that, you gie up one of the better young WRs in the league for an older less productive WR, where WR is already your weak spot, and you have to march at minimum 3 of them out there each week. At least with Fitz you have one guy that is a solid option week in and week out.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
